Probiotics are live microorganisms that, when consumed in adequate amounts, confer health benefits to the host. They are often referred to as “good bacteria” and are found in various fermented foods and dietary supplements. Oral probiotics have been linked to improved digestive health, enhanced immune responses, and even better oral health. However, for these benefits to manifest, timing can be a crucial factor.
One of the most researched periods for taking probiotics is on an empty stomach. Consuming oral probiotics about 30 minutes before a meal or at least two hours after a meal can enhance the survival rate of the beneficial bacteria. When taken on an empty stomach, the pH of the stomach is less acidic, which creates a more favorable environment for the probiotics to survive as they journey through the harsh gastrointestinal tract. This increased survival rate allows more beneficial bacteria to reach the intestines, where they can exert their health-promoting effects.

It is also essential to consider the type of probiotic you are consuming, as different strains may have varying recommendations for timing. For example, some strains are more effective when taken with food, while others may thrive better on an empty stomach. It’s advisable to read the product instructions carefully or consult with a healthcare professional to determine the best timing specific to the probiotic you are using.
While timing is important, consistency is another crucial factor in obtaining the maximum benefits from probiotics. Regular consumption enhances the gut microbiota’s stability and diversity. A daily regimen ensures a steady influx of beneficial bacteria, allowing for a more balanced gut environment. Skipping days can lead to fluctuations in gut health and reduce the potential advantages.
